Fire in abandoned downtown home spreads to adjacent building
A fire broke out in an abandoned building in downtown Fresno Sunday afternoon, and then it spread the building next door, the Fresno Fire Department said.
The fire broke out shortly after 4 p.m. in an abandoned house on F and Los Angeles streets.
At first firefighters thought the fire was contained to one building and then realized it had spread to the adjacent one.
Although the buildings are abandoned, the area has had issues with squatters and transients, Fresno Fire Battalion Chief Thomas Cope said.
The cause of the fire is under investigation.
